Abstract
一種可組合的插座結構,包括一固定組及一轉動組。固定組包含一本體,本體相對的兩側分別設有插接腳及插接孔,插接孔的內側設有第一導電片,第一導電片電性連接於插接腳,本體的另一側設有通孔,通孔的內側設有第二導電片,第二導電片為通用型導電片,第二導電片電性連接於插接腳。轉動組套設於固定組的本體的外部,轉動組能在固定組上轉動,轉動組上間隔的設置有多組插座孔,能轉動該轉動組,選擇轉動組上所需規格的一組插座孔對應於固定組的通孔及第二導電片。藉此,可供多種不同規格的插頭插接,且可輕易的變換至所需規格的插座孔,並可將多個插座結構串接組合使用。 A combination socket structure includes a fixed group and a rotating group. The fixing group includes a main body, and the two opposite sides of the main body are respectively provided with a plug pin and a plug hole. A first conductive sheet is provided on the inner side of the plug hole, and the first conductive sheet is electrically connected to the plug pin. A through hole is provided on the side, and a second conductive sheet is provided on the inner side of the through hole. The second conductive sheet is a general-purpose conductive sheet, and the second conductive sheet is electrically connected to the pin. The rotation group is set on the outside of the body of the fixed group. The rotation group can be rotated on the fixed group. Multiple groups of socket holes are provided at intervals on the rotation group. The rotation group can be rotated to select a group of sockets of the required size on the rotation group. The holes correspond to the through holes of the fixing group and the second conductive sheet. In this way, a variety of plugs of different specifications can be plugged in, and can be easily changed to the socket holes of the required specification, and multiple socket structures can be used in series.

請參閱圖1及圖2,本發明提供一種可組合的插座結構,包括一固定組1及一轉動組3。 Please refer to FIG. 1 and FIG. 2. The present invention provides a combination socket structure including a fixed group 1 and a rotating group 3.
該固定組1包含一本體11,該本體11以塑膠等絕緣材料製成,該本體11可為單件或多件的構造,其構造並不限制,可因應需要適當的變化。本體11相對的兩側(前側及後側)分別設有插接腳12及插接孔13,插接腳12以導電材料製成,插接腳12可用以插接於適當的插座裝置上,用以輸入所需的電力或訊號。插接 孔13貫穿本體11的內壁及外壁,插接腳12及插接孔13呈相對的設置,以便串接組合多個插座結構。插接腳12及插接孔13設置的數量並不限制,可以是兩個或三個等。 The fixing group 1 includes a main body 11 made of an insulating material such as plastic. The main body 11 may be a single piece or a plurality of pieces. The structure is not limited and may be appropriately changed according to requirements. The opposite sides (front and rear) of the main body 11 are provided with plug pins 12 and plug holes 13, respectively. The plug pins 12 are made of conductive material, and the plug pins 12 can be used to plug into appropriate socket devices. Used to enter the required power or signal. Docking The hole 13 penetrates the inner wall and the outer wall of the body 11, and the plug pins 12 and the plug holes 13 are oppositely arranged so as to connect and combine multiple socket structures in series. The number of the insertion pins 12 and the insertion holes 13 is not limited, and may be two or three.
該插接孔13的內側設有第一導電片14,第一導電片14能通過第一導線15、導電材料或電路板等方式電性連接於插接腳12,使得電力或訊號可通過插接腳12傳輸至第一導電片14。當電器用品的插頭的插接腳或另一插座結構的插接腳12插接於插接孔13時,可與第一導電片14接觸,以便傳輸電力或訊號至該電器用品或另一插座結構。 A first conductive sheet 14 is provided on the inner side of the plug hole 13, and the first conductive sheet 14 can be electrically connected to the plug pin 12 through a first wire 15, a conductive material, or a circuit board, so that power or signals can be inserted through the plug. The pins 12 are transmitted to the first conductive sheet 14. When the plug pin of the plug of the electrical appliance or the plug pin 12 of another socket structure is inserted into the plug hole 13, it can be in contact with the first conductive sheet 14 in order to transmit power or signals to the electrical appliance or another socket structure.
該本體11的另一側可設有通孔16,通孔16貫穿本體11的內壁及外壁,通孔16可為通用型(或稱萬用型)的插孔,以便各種規格的插頭的插接腳皆能插置於通孔16中。該本體11內設有第二導電片17,第二導電片17可設於通孔16的內側,該第二導電片17為一通用型導電片,可用以與多種不同規格的插頭的插接腳達成電性連接。該第二導電片17能通過第二導線18、導電材料或電路板等方式電性連接於插接腳12,使得電力或訊號可通過插接腳12傳輸至第二導電片17。當電器用品的插頭的插接腳插接於轉動組3及通孔16,可與第二導電片17接觸,以便傳輸電力或訊號至電器用品的插頭。 The other side of the body 11 may be provided with a through hole 16, which penetrates the inner wall and the outer wall of the body 11. The through hole 16 may be a universal (or universal) jack, so as to facilitate the plugs of various specifications. The plug pins can be inserted into the through holes 16. The body 11 is provided with a second conductive sheet 17, which can be disposed inside the through hole 16. The second conductive sheet 17 is a general-purpose conductive sheet and can be used for plugging with various plugs of different specifications. The feet are electrically connected. The second conductive sheet 17 can be electrically connected to the pin 12 through a second wire 18, a conductive material, or a circuit board, so that power or signals can be transmitted to the second conductive sheet 17 through the pin 12. When the plug pins of the plugs of the electrical appliances are inserted into the rotation group 3 and the through holes 16, they can be in contact with the second conductive sheet 17 so as to transmit power or signals to the plugs of the electrical appliances.
該轉動組3為一中空體,其可呈多邊形體或圓形體,其形狀並不限制。該轉動組3套設於固定組1的本體11的外部,轉動組3能在固定組1上轉動。在本實施例中,轉動組3的內部設有一圓形樞孔31,且於固定組1的本體11的外部形成一相對應的圓形柱體19,轉動組3的圓形樞孔31套設於固定組1的圓形柱體19,使得轉動組3可在固定組1上自由地轉動。 The rotation group 3 is a hollow body, which can be polygonal or circular, and its shape is not limited. The rotation group 3 is set on the outside of the body 11 of the fixed group 1. The rotation group 3 can rotate on the fixed group 1. In this embodiment, a circular pivot hole 31 is provided inside the rotation group 3, and a corresponding circular cylinder 19 is formed on the outside of the body 11 of the fixed group 1. The circular pivot hole 31 of the rotation group 3 is set The circular cylinder 19 provided on the fixed group 1 allows the rotation group 3 to rotate freely on the fixed group 1.
該轉動組3上間隔的設置有多組插座孔32,該些插座孔32貫穿轉動組3的內壁及外壁,該些插座孔32為不同的規格,例如可包含一孔、兩孔、三孔及其他數量的多孔型式,可包含長扁孔 及圓孔等形狀,該些插座孔32的規格並不限制,可為台灣、大陸、義大利、美國、澳洲、歐洲等各種規格。 The rotation group 3 is provided with a plurality of socket holes 32 at intervals. The socket holes 32 penetrate the inner wall and the outer wall of the rotation group 3. The socket holes 32 are of different specifications, for example, they can include one hole, two holes, and three holes. Porosity and other number of porous patterns, can include long flat holes The shape of the socket holes 32 is not limited, and may be various specifications such as Taiwan, China, Italy, the United States, Australia, and Europe.
使用者能轉動該轉動組3,以選擇轉動組3上所需規格的一組插座孔32對應於固定組1的通孔16及第二導電片17,如此即可將電器用品的插頭的插接腳通過轉動組3插座孔32,進而插接於固定組1的通孔16中,該電器用品的插頭的插接腳即可與固定組1的第二導電片17接觸達成電性連接,使電源或訊號得以傳輸至電器用品。 The user can rotate the rotation group 3 to select a group of socket holes 32 of the required specifications on the rotation group 3 corresponding to the through holes 16 and the second conductive piece 17 of the fixing group 1, so that the plugs of the electrical appliances can be inserted. The pins are inserted into the through holes 16 of the fixing group 1 by rotating the socket holes 32 of the group 3, and the plug pins of the plug of the electrical appliance can contact the second conductive piece 17 of the fixing group 1 to achieve an electrical connection. Allows power or signals to be transmitted to electrical appliances.
當使用不同規格的電器用品的插頭的插接腳時,使用者則可再次轉動轉動組3,使轉動組3的上與插頭的插接腳相同規格的另一組插座孔32對應於固定組1的通孔16及第二導電片17,如此即可將電器用品的插頭的插接腳通過轉動組3的插座孔32,進而插接於固定組1的通孔16中,該電器用品的插頭的插接腳即可與固定組1的第二導電片17接觸達成電性連接,使電源或訊號得以傳輸至電器用品。 When using the plug pins of plugs of electrical appliances of different specifications, the user can turn the rotation group 3 again, so that the other group of socket holes 32 on the rotation group 3 with the same specifications as the plug pins correspond to the fixing group 1 through hole 16 and the second conductive sheet 17, so that the plug pins of the plug of the electrical appliance can pass through the socket hole 32 of the rotation group 3, and then be inserted into the through hole 16 of the fixed group 1, The plug pins of the plug can contact the second conductive piece 17 of the fixing group 1 to achieve an electrical connection, so that the power supply or signal can be transmitted to the electrical appliances.

請參閱圖13,在該實施例中,該插座結構上設置有馬達6及傳動機構7,馬達6及傳動機構7設置至少一個,馬達6可固定於固定組1上,馬達6可通過一開關(圖略)驅動。馬達6可通過傳動機構7連接於轉動組3,在本實施例中,傳動機構7為一齒輪組,該齒輪組包含一連接於馬達6的第一齒輪71及一設置於轉動組3上的第二齒輪72,第一齒輪71及第二齒輪72相互嚙合。當驅動馬達6轉動時,可通過第一齒輪71及第二齒輪72傳動轉動組3轉動,以便利用電動方式轉動該轉動組3。該插座結構的全部或部份轉動組3可利用電動方式轉動。 Please refer to FIG. 13. In this embodiment, the socket structure is provided with a motor 6 and a transmission mechanism 7. At least one of the motor 6 and the transmission mechanism 7 is provided. The motor 6 can be fixed on the fixed group 1 and the motor 6 can be switched by a switch. (Figure omitted) drive. The motor 6 can be connected to the rotation group 3 through a transmission mechanism 7. In this embodiment, the transmission mechanism 7 is a gear group. The gear group includes a first gear 71 connected to the motor 6 and a gear set provided on the rotation group 3. The second gear 72, the first gear 71, and the second gear 72 mesh with each other. When the driving motor 6 rotates, the rotation group 3 can be driven to rotate by the first gear 71 and the second gear 72 so as to rotate the rotation group 3 electrically. All or part of the rotation group 3 of the socket structure can be rotated by electric means.
